Indicators of Oral Emergency Situations



Acknowledging the signs of dental emergencies is essential for timely action and proper therapy. If you experience serious tooth discomfort that's constant and pain, it could show an underlying problem that calls for instant attention.

Swelling in dental implant o rings , face, or jaw can likewise suggest a dental emergency, especially if it's accompanied by discomfort or fever. Any type of sort of injury to the mouth resulting in a fractured, damaged, or knocked-out tooth ought to be treated as an emergency to stop further damage and possible infection.

Bleeding from the mouth that does not stop after applying pressure for a few mins is an additional red flag that you must seek emergency oral treatment. In addition, if you observe any indications of infection such as pus, a foul preference in your mouth, or a fever, it's essential to see a dental expert immediately.

Neglecting these indicators could bring about a lot more severe problems, so it's essential to act promptly when confronted with a prospective dental emergency.
